About Alben Cardenas
Alben Cardenas is a scholar working on Energy Engineering and Power Technology, Automotive Engineering and Control and Systems Engineering, having authored 74 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Smart Grid Energy Management (27 papers), Microgrid Control and Optimization (23 papers) and Building Energy and Comfort Optimization (16 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Energy Engineering and Power Technology (137 citations), Building and Construction (331 cit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(976 citations). Alben Cardenas has collaborated with scholars based in Canada, Algeria and Colombia. Frequent co-authors include Kodjo Agbossou, Sousso Kélouwani, Sayed Saeed Hosseini, Yves Dubé, Nilson Henao, Hossein Mousazadeh, M. Hammoudi, Mamadou Lamine Doumbia, Loïc Boulon and Wilmar Martínez.
